9 Claims (01. 211-99) The present invention relates to supporting racks and more particularly to retracting racks.
The main objects of the invention are to provide a supporting rack which is automatically retracting when the supported weight is removed therefrom; to provide a plurality of nested racks of the character above indicated particularly adapted for use when installed in a kitchen for supporting towels, dish cloths and the like; and, to provide such a device which is saleable as a kitchen accessory, is convenient in use, and is economical to manufacture.

Referring to the drawing in which like parts of the structure are designated by the same numerals in the several views, the embodiment of the device shown in Figures 1 to 5 comprises a triangularly formed back plate I, preferably of stamped sheet metal, whose opposite sides 2, 3 are laterally flanged rearwardly to form diverging inclined side surfaces and whose lower end 4 is likewise laterally and rearwardly flanged. The upper and lower ends of the plate are each respectively provided with a screw receiving aperture 5, 6 for securing the plate against a fiat surface such as the wall of a kitchen.
A pair of spaced channel bar elements 1, 8, likewise of stamped sheet metal, are parallelly disposed and secured to the rear side of the plate as by spot welding and each element is provided with a linear series of spaced and laterally registering apertures 9. Each series of apertures in the element 1, 8 are in lateral registration with a like series of apertures II] in the laterally flanged and diverging inclined side surfaces 2, 3
of the plate.
' A plurality of springable bails or split loops I l each of progressively differing diameter and preferably of wire, have their opposite ends passing 5 through their respective apertures 9, It! on op posite sides of the plate and to which each bail is thus pivotally secured. Portions I2 of each of the bails near each of their opposite ends and adjacent the flanged diverging inclined side sur- 10 faces 2, 3 of the plate are laterally bent, as best shown in Figures 1, 4 and 5, to contact and ride upon the adjacent inclined and diverging side surfaces of the plate in the downwardly swinging movement of a given bail relative to its back plate. 0
Inmanually swinging of any of the several. bails downwardly from their position shown in Figure 3 to the position shown in Figure 2, the opposite ends of the bail are caused to spread by the contact of the portions I! with the diverging inclined surfaces of the flanged sides 2, 3 of the plate and thereby increase the tensional contact between the bent portions of the bail and their respective inclined surfaces. Towelsor the like which may thus be hung on the bails and by their weight retain them in a substantially horizontal position, when removed permit the bail to automatically retract to the vertical nesting position shown in Figure 3.
In the embodiment of the invention shown in Figures 6 and '7, the back plate l3 may be rectangularly formed from stamped sheet metal and provided with rearwardly flanged sides l4, each side being provided with a series of vertically spaced and laterally registering bail receiving apertures I5.
The back plate of this modified embodiment of the invention is provided with a series of vertically disposed spaced fins l6 blanked therefrom as best shown in Figure 7 and angularly disposed on opposite sides of the plate in spaced relation to the respective opposite marginal sides of the plate. Each fin is provided with a bail receiving aperture I! in lateral registration with its coopcrating aperture IS on opposite sides of the plate and the opposite ends I8= of each bail thus pivotally connected to the plate are laterally bent to contact and ride upon the inclined surface of op- 50 positely disposed pairs of fins to effect tensional engagement of the ends of the loop therewith in the swinging movement of the bail relative to the plate. Here again, towels, dish cloths and the like suspended from a given bail in its horizontal 5 position, when removed permit the bail to automatically retract to a vertical nesting position.
It will thus be seen that the supporting racks of the device automatically retract to nesting vertical position when the supported weight is removed therefrom and that the device is convenient in use and economical to manufacture.
